"Raucous fun! Bad puns, circus tricks and goggle-eyed jellyfish abound" (The Guardian)
3 – 8 year olds and their families will love this adaptation of Julia Donaldson and Lydia Monks’ hugely popular book, brought to life with beautiful puppetry and performance, and music and songs by Barb Jungr (We’re Going on a Bear Hunt).
Did you ever go to Silversands
On a sunny summer’s day?
Then perhaps you saw the mermaid
Who sang in the deep blue bay
One day the singing mermaid is tempted away from all of her sea-creature friends to join a travelling circus. The audiences love to hear her sing, but the poor mermaid was tricked! Instead of the swimming pool she was promised, she is kept in a small fish tank by the wicked circus master Sam Sly. She longs to return to the sea, but how can she escape? And who could help her along the way?
Watershed Productions present the Little Angel Theatre and Royal & Derngate, Northampton, production of The Singing Mermaid by Julia Donaldson and Lydia Monks
Adapted by Samantha Lane and Barb Jungr
Music and Lyrics by Barb Jungr
Original production by Samantha Lane
Associate Director Oliver Hymans
Design by Laura McEwen
Lighting Design by Sherry Coenen
Puppets by Lyndie Wright
